Major clinical symptoms of this syndrome are facial nerve paresis or paralysis, vesicles in nervous tracings, and otalgia. Especially, face asymmetry occurs due to the affected facial nerve. Although, survival of this syndrome is good, prognosis of facial symptoms is poor and complete degeneration of the nerve may occur.
